Back to the topic at hand, I think OP should ease himself into FW resins by adding upgrade kits to plastic infantry.  The pieces are small enough that you can fix warpage with a normal hair dryer, and you'll get a feel for how it cuts differently from plastic.  Those parts are also less likely to need sanding, which is relatively dangerous with resin (do it under running water and/or wearing a mask - resin dust scratches the inside of your lungs).  Granted, it's not too hard to build an army using only plastic 40k bits.

I think it's actually easier to assemble a Land Speeder Javelin than a plastic Land Speeder, but the latter work well in the game, especially with graviton guns.  Attack Bikes don't have an Outrider-styled equivalent so you can use those too, ideally with Mk IV torsos and heads.

The easier plastic+resin tanks to assemble are probably the Land Raider Mk IIb (plastic LR + resin sponsons and front hull piece) and the Fellblade family.  In those cases it's kind of nice to have the plastic pieces to keep everything straight and square.  I don't think the Deimos-pattern Rhino-chassis variants go together as easily - it's easier to build an all-resin Sicaran than any of them.  

Avoid the Storm Eagle/Fire Raptor, they need to be redesigned imo.
